Abstract
We present the first polynomial time algorithm for testing t-diagnosability. This is a significant advance in system level fault diagnosis. We also presented part of our analysis of t/s-diagnosability, including the fact that it is co-NP-complete and that there are polynomial algorithms for t/t and t/(t+1)-diagnosability.
